Position: Revenue Mgmt Advisor I

The Revenue Management Advisor I provides insight and advice to customers from both a Revenue Management and general operations perspective. Revenue Managers collaborate with representatives at all levels of the organization to understand and implement strategy as well as track and review overall performance.

  • Build and maintain relationships with customers and internal Real Page staff.
  • Review pricing recommendations with or on the customers behalf to ensure customer adoption and satisfaction.
  • Regular discussions with site, regional and asset managers related to pricing questions.
  • Consult with customers on operational questions related to Revenue Management.
  • Consult with customers on parameter reviews and tuning.
  • Articulate the revenue management value proposition and develop credibility for its concepts and benefits across client organizations.
  • Efficiently run multiple projects and use Salesforce to track and update project steps.
  • Effectively communicate technical items to IT Tech or Support and follow-up to ensure customer satisfaction.
  • Maintain a working knowledge of the integration with each Property Management System.
  • Identify opportunities for ongoing learning to ensure Revenue Management is fully adopted by the customer.
  • Prioritize requests for system enhancements and coordinate follow-up with the Real Page or customer’s product management group.
  • Provide input and feedback, from a business user’s perspective to the Real Page Product group, on solution features and functionality.
  • Coordinate with other Real Page teams as needed to facilitate timely implementation and overall client success.
  • Coordinate regular performance calls reporting to management regarding financial results, revenue management adoption behavior, leasing velocity and market conditions.
